首页 > 关于图片,视频等保存数据库的问题,谢谢

关于图片,视频等保存数据库的问题,谢谢

1.以前我咨询过一些前辈,他们说将图片和视频以文件形式保存在服务器上比较好(一般会腾出一台专门放上传文件的服务器),因为数据库写入写出太消耗资源。

2.那我想问下如果有一天用户突然要迁移项目到另一台服务器,比如原来的服务器,图片都是存放在D://pic//目录下,然而新的服务器没有D://盘符怎么办?


1.只要目录结构没有改变,路径改变应该很容易的;
2.对于访问比较频繁,而且可以公开的图片,推荐使用七牛等存储服务,这样一方面减少服务器压力,另外cdn之后,访问也更快。


数据库中存储文件的路径就不应该用绝对路径,


图片与视频资源都放在单独的服务器,都会用单独域名访问的,比如img.xxx.com ,所以迁移服务器不影响,就算路径变了,也可以用rewrite重写的。


数据库一般存的是资源的路径,项目里一般用的都是相对路径,绝对路径应该用得很少的,用相对路径,项目迁移基本不会出问题。


肯定是单独的服务器,数据库存放链接,数据库如果有某个字段值过大的话,会影响整个表的查询效率。


在学校学数据库原理这门课时老师曾反复提过这个问题,当时不太理解,后来选修JSP/Servlet,那个老师拿到什么都往数据库里放,然后我就凌乱了。。。

【热门文章】
【热门文章】